Trying to exec more may not work here.  Next time this happens, can
you just write down some of the pids from top output that are in
tstile, and ask crash to, e.g., `bt 0t18999'?  (`0t' means decimal
input, as opposed to the default hexadecimal.)

Another useful indication is the `flt_no' wchan (which likely means
one of the flt_noram[123456] waits), which suggests that the uvm pager
is stuck waiting for something -- probably waiting for the pager
daemon to do disk I/O, and all the other processes are probably stuck
waiting for a lock held by someone stuck in disk I/O.
